What is a Port Community System?

A Port Community System is a centralized digital platform that enables secure information exchange between stakeholders involved in port and maritime operations. It connects port authorities, terminal operators, shipping lines, customs, freight forwarders, transporters, and other participants through a shared digital environment.

By replacing fragmented communication

and manual documentation with standardized digital workflows, a Port Community System improves cargo visibility, reduces processing delays, simplifies coordination, and supports more efficient port operations.

What is a Port Community System?
A Port Community System is a centralized digital platform that connects different stakeholders involved in port and maritime operations. It enables secure information exchange between port authorities, terminal operators, shipping lines, customs, freight forwarders, transporters, and other participants.
How does a Port Community System improve port efficiency?
It digitizes information exchange, documentation, notifications, and operational workflows, helping reduce manual processes, communication gaps, paperwork, and unnecessary delays across port operations.
Can a Port Community System integrate with existing port and logistics systems?
Yes. A Port Community System can integrate with port management systems, terminal operating systems, customs platforms, shipping applications, ERP systems, and other logistics technologies to facilitate connected information exchange.
Who can use a Port Community System?
Port authorities, terminal operators, shipping lines, customs agencies, freight forwarders, logistics providers, transport companies, and other maritime stakeholders can use a Port Community System to coordinate port and cargo operations.
